This xiiflvyramlric^was composed on horse- back ; in riding in~ThlT~miojdle of tempests, over the wildest Galloway moor, in company with a Mr. Syme, 25 who, observing the poet's looks, forbore to speak, judiciously enough, for a man composing BrucJs Address might be unsafe to trifle with. Doubtless this stern hymn was singing itself, as he formed it, through the soul of Burns : but to the external ear, it should be sung 30 with the throat of the whirlwind. So long as there is warm blood in the ...heart of Scotchman or man, it will move in fierce thrills under this war-ode ; the best, we believe, that was ever written by any pen.
